
/* big tablets to 1200pxs: (widths smaller than the 1140px row) */
@media only screen and (max-width: 1200px) {

    .row {padding: 0 2%; }
    
 .main-nav li {
     font-size: 0.95em;
     margin-left: 0.9em !important;
    
    }
    
 

    

}




/* small tablet to big tablets: from 768 to 1023px */
@media only screen and (max-width: 1023px) {
    
    
    
   .main-nav { display: none; }
    
   .mobile-nav-icon {
           display: inline-block;
}
    
    
  
   
 
    
    .main-nav { 
                margin-top: 170px;        
                 }
    
   .main-nav li {
        display: block; 
        z-index: 9999;
        width: 120%;
       text-align: center;
       position: relative;
                     
    }
    
   
    
 
    /* main drop down */
    
    .main-nav li a:link,
    .main-nav li a:visited {
        display: block; 
        background-color: #1abc9c;
        border: 0;
        padding: 10px 5px;
        
        
    }    
     

  
    
    .sticky .main-nav { margin-right: 40px;
                        margin-top: 70px; 
                        padding: 0;
                        z-index: 99999; }
    
    .sticky .main-nav li a:link,
    .sticky .main-nav li a:visited { padding: 10px; }
    
    .sticky .mobile-nav-icon {margin-top: 10px; 
                                
                                 }
  
    .sticky .mobile-nav-icon i {color: #555;
                                    
        
                               
    }
    
    
  
   
   
  





/* small phones to small tablets: from 481 to 767px */
@media only screen and (max-width: 767px) {
  
  
    
 
}



/* small phones: from 0 to 480px */
@media only screen and (max-width: 480px) {
    
    .sticky .main-nav {
        max-width: 140px;
        margin-top: 20px;
        
    }
    h3 { font-size: 250%; }
    
    .main-nav { margin-top: 170px;
                float: left; }
    
    .logo-black { margin-right: 120px; }
    
    .sticky .mobile-nav-icon {margin-left: 50px;                         
                                 }
    
    .photo {
    width: 40%;
    height: auto;
    margin-right: 20px;
    margin-bottom: 10px;
    }
}